Abstract: Marine mammal aerial surveys were conducted from 30 August through 4 September 2013 in the Pacific Northwest inland Puget Sound waters. This effort was in support of Marine Mammal Protection Act permit monitoring requirements for the U.S. Navy to conduct marine mammal studies in waters on or adjacent to U.S. Naval installations in the inland Puget Sound Region, as well as offshore in the existing Northwest Training Range Complex (NWTRC) and Naval Undersea Warfare Center (NUWC) Keyport Dabob Bay Range Complex (together known as the Northwest Training and Testing Study Area). Data are from one survey conducted under contract by Smultea Environmental Sciences (SES) and issued by HDR, Inc. There were 779 marine mammal sightings of over 1,716 animals representing 5,785 km (3,124 nm) of flight (both on and off effort).
